Output c62866af6280e222e02a160fde45910b3caff0cb2517cb7db7dea8453d21738e:1

value
38882370
script pubkey
OP_0 OP_PUSHBYTES_20 02ca0f568f2c628452f1cc479f7cfb1f6e49b98f
address
bc1qqt9q7450933gg5h3e3re7l8mrahynwv0yrpl72
transaction
c62866af6280e222e02a160fde45910b3caff0cb2517cb7db7dea8453d21738e
confirmations
144284
spent
true